The Ultimate Guide to Updating Ender 3 Firmware: Step-by-Step Tutorial

Keeping your Creality Ender 3 current with the latest firmware is one of the most effective ways to unlock better print quality, resolve mysterious errors, and expand the capabilities of your 3D printer. While the stock firmware that ships with the printer is functional, it often lacks the advanced features and stability improvements that the community has developed over years of collective tinkering.

Why Updating the Firmware Matters

Before diving into the "how," it is essential to understand the "why." Firmware is the low-level software that controls every movement, temperature, and sensor on your Ender 3. Outdated firmware can struggle with newer slicing software, leading to glitches or failed prints. By updating, you gain access to features such as advanced bed leveling, thermal runaway protection, and support for additional hardware like direct extrusion or auto bed leveling probes.

Preparation: Tools and Safety

Flashing firmware incorrectly can brick your motherboard, rendering the printer inoperable. Therefore, preparation is paramount. You need a reliable computer, a USB cable (usually micro-USB), and a stable power supply. It is highly recommended to use a surge protector or an uninterruptible power supply (UPS) to prevent corruption caused by sudden power loss. Furthermore, ensure you have the correct firmware file for your specific motherboard variant, as installing the wrong file can cause hardware conflicts.

The Manual Flashing Process

The most common method involves manually placing the firmware file onto a MicroSD card or connecting the printer via USB to use the updater software. If using a MicroSD card, you typically need to copy the .bin file directly to the root directory of the card, insert it into the printer's slot, and power on the device. The printer screen will usually display a progress bar, followed by a reboot indicating the update was successful. This method is often preferred because it does not require the computer to remain connected during the entire process.

Using the Updater Software

For the USB method, navigate to the firmware updater on your computer, select the correct COM port, and browse to the .bin file location. After initiating the update, the software will communicate directly with the motherboard. During this process, the screen on the printer may go blank or display a "flashing" animation. It is critical not to disconnect the power or USB cable during this phase, as doing so will likely corrupt the motherboard and require professional repair.

Verification and Troubleshooting

Once the update cycle is complete, you should verify the success of the operation. Power cycle the printer and check the firmware version in the settings menu; it should match the version number of the file you installed. If the printer fails to boot or behaves erratically, you may need to reflash the firmware. Persistent issues often stem from a corrupted SD card, a faulty USB port, or an incompatible firmware file, so double-checking these variables is the first step in troubleshooting.
